Open in app

Sign In

Write

Sign In

Mog Nesbitt
Mog Nesbitt

380 Followers

Home

About

Nov 16, 2021

What is a strategy?

Our organisation has a purpose we’re continuously striving for, and a set of values we operate within. We have infinite possibility ahead of us but we have finite time, people, resources and money. We can see a hundred paths from here stretching out to the horizon, all potentially leading us…

Strategy

2 min read

What is a strategy?
What is a strategy?
Strategy

2 min read


Sep 10, 2018

Why your huge tech team isn’t delivering

“Our team used to go fast when it was small. Now we have ten times as many people and less work gets done. What happened?!” Short answer: Your workstream is controlled by people whose job it is to ship more features, and your software engineers think their job is to…

Team Building

9 min read

Why your huge tech team isn’t delivering
Why your huge tech team isn’t delivering
Team Building

9 min read


Sep 11, 2017

One-on-one catchups with your team

Of all the things you can do for your team, the one-on-one catchup is the most important. Bin all your other meetings, but keep these ones! In this article, I’ll cover why we do catchups, present a template for running your own catchups with some sample questions, and give some…

Management

9 min read

Management

9 min read


Jan 10, 2017

Why hire for diversity?

Talking with other leaders, I often find a confusion about what “diversity” in hiring means and why it’s worth caring about. This is my attempt to explain what I’ve learned. What does diversity mean, in this context? Diversity is sometimes used as a keyword for “equal numbers of women and men”, but that’s a very narrow definition…

Diversity

6 min read

Diversity

6 min read


Jan 9, 2017

What next for you, software developer?

You’ve been coding for a few years now. You feel competent at your preferred languages. You’re not making too many silly mistakes, and although you’re learning a bit every now and then from articles you read and teammates, you’re not feeling the passion for coding that you once did. The…

Software Development

7 min read

What next for you, software developer?
What next for you, software developer?
Software Development

7 min read


Jan 8, 2017

Naming software developer roles

Junior Developer. Senior Engineer. It’s funny that we use these terms, usually reserved for age, to refer to the level of responsibility and pay given to a software developer. But clearly, age isn’t what we’re measuring. There are 24-year-olds who have packed in enough experience to be classified as “senior”…

Software Development

4 min read

Naming software developer roles
Naming software developer roles
Software Development

4 min read


Oct 24, 2016

Tests aren’t for code you’ve just written

You’ve been coding a couple of years, and in your first commercial job you’re introduced to automated tests. The experienced devs are saying they’re a crucial part of writing software. But you don’t see why you should use them. They’re time consuming to write, and hard to write well. …

Software Development

3 min read

Software Development

3 min read


Oct 20, 2016

The winding path of being a developer

Learning to code is a lifelong endeavour. Around every corner, you find more to learn that you didn’t know existed. I talk to a lot of compsci students, and many of them are under the impression that they learn to code at university, and then just go apply that knowledge…

Programming

8 min read

The winding path of being a developer
The winding path of being a developer
Programming

8 min read


Oct 19, 2016

Negotiating salary: a developer HOWTO

In Wellington, New Zealand, the majority of developer salaries I’ve seen range from $50,000 to $140,000. It’s a huge range, and humans—also known as management—make the decision about how much they’re going to pay you solely based upon spending an hour or two with you. Salary isn’t the only thing…

Tech

6 min read

Negotiating salary: a developer HOWTO
Negotiating salary: a developer HOWTO
Tech

6 min read


Oct 17, 2016

Building a great culture in your tech team

Ask many people to explain what a great work culture looks like, and they’ll look at you as if to say “you know… a great culture!” And then they might talk about beers on a Friday, the coffee machine, or flexitime. I had the pleasure of helping grow a delivery…

Culture

7 min read

Culture

7 min read

Mog Nesbitt

Mog Nesbitt

380 Followers

Leading technology teams

Following
  • Dion Almaer

    Dion Almaer

  • Laura K. Lawless

    Laura K. Lawless

  • Tanya Gray

    Tanya Gray

  • Jason Fried

    Jason Fried

  • Samantha Judd

    Samantha Judd

See all (85)

Help

Status

Writers

Blog

Careers

Privacy

Terms

About

Text to speech

Teams